Hello all, I have a 99 XLT 4wd with a 31 inch Goodyear wranglers. They tend to make a lot of noise around 30 to 35 mph and going up through and coming back down through that speed range. It is a loud humming noise and vibration that sounds like the tires are at a resonant frequency of something. The tires have roughly 15k on them.

Is this normal? I'm used to all seasons or summer tires on my other vehicles.
 
There are a few Wrangler tread versions.

The more aggressive(open) the tread design the noisier it will be, so it can be "normal" but not desired :).
Larger openings in the tread allow more air to be trapped and compressed under the tire which makes noise, if you run higher or lower air pressure you can change the noise a bit and at what MPH it is loudest
Obviously the road material matters as well
